Are AOT Fortnite skins still available in the Item Shop
As of late 2023 and early 2024, the AOT Fortnite skins Eren Jaeger, Mikasa Ackerman, and Captain Levi Ackerman are not currently available in the Item Shop. Eren Jaeger was a Chapter 4 Season 2 Battle Pass reward, making him exclusive to that season's owners. Mikasa and Levi appeared as limited-time Item Shop offerings and their return is not guaranteed due to licensing agreements.
When did the AOT Fortnite skins first release
The AOT Fortnite skins first began rolling out during Fortnite Chapter 4 Season 2. Eren Jaeger was obtainable through the Battle Pass in early 2023, unlocking around March 2023. Mikasa Ackerman and Captain Levi Ackerman subsequently arrived in the Item Shop in April 2023, generating immense excitement among fans of both franchises.
How much did the Mikasa Ackerman and Captain Levi skins cost
When Mikasa Ackerman and Captain Levi Ackerman AOT Fortnite skins were available in the Item Shop, they typically cost 1,500 V-Bucks each for the individual outfit. Players could also purchase bundles that included additional cosmetic items like pickaxes and back blings for approximately 2,200 V-Bucks, offering a complete themed set for a slightly higher price.

Will the ODM gear return to Fortnite gameplay
The ODM gear, a popular mobility and attack item from the AOT Fortnite collaboration, is currently vaulted and not available in standard game modes. While Epic Games occasionally brings back vaulted items for special events or limited-time modes, there's no official word on if or when the ODM gear will make a permanent return to Fortnite gameplay in 2026 or beyond.

What is the ODM Gear in Fortnite AOT Fortnite skins explained
The ODM gear in Fortnite was a unique Mythic mobility item inspired by Attack on Titan. It allowed players to grapple and swing through the air, reminiscent of how characters moved in the anime. It also enabled powerful slashing attacks against opponents or structures, adding a dynamic and exciting combat element to the game during its availability.
